**Mgmt Meeting Minutes — Retiring the Brightline Range**

Quick recap for sales leads at Fenholt Supplies: we agreed to retire the Brightline fixture range by year-end. Remaining stock moves to clearance pricing next month, and accounts on standing orders get migrated to the Lumetta range. Trade-in incentives were approved in principle. The confidential note on next steps sits just below.

board note of bajof-bajeg: The pricing group signed off on a budget of $13.4 million for Project Sildor. The renewal with Lamixek Holdings closes at $48.9 million a year, 49 percent above the last contract.

Handover for on-call: the Duskwell backfill scheduler stalls if a nightly run overlaps the 02:00 compaction job on the Ferrowline cluster. Mitigation: pause the queue, let compaction finish, then resume — jobs are idempotent. If the scheduler's admin panel is locked after three failed resumes, unlock it with the recovery passphrase given below.

strongbox words: sorir-belvan-rusix-ulays-ralmir-praix-eliir-tamax-praael-druael-julir-tamius-jorir

CI troubleshooting — QuickAddr autocomplete widget. If the suggestion-dropdown e2e tests flake, it's almost always the mock geocoder container starting slowly; the widget times out and falls back to manual entry, which the assertions hate. Bump the container health-check wait in the pipeline config before blaming the widget itself. Also clear the cached suggestion index between runs, or stale entries from Brindlemoor test data leak in. When escalating to the platform crew, quote the build token printed below.

trace token, hadup-kafof: htk14_fef3ca2e878e64

Key terms: seven-year term, 5.5% royalty on net sales, a capped marketing levy, and fit-out standards audited annually. Modelled payback for the franchisee is just under four years under conservative footfall assumptions. Outstanding items: supply-pricing indexation clause and termination triggers, both with counsel. The strategic rationale and planned territory sequencing are set out confidentially below.

confidential, hadup-yaguf: Briielox Systems plans to raise the Holax list price by 5 percent in July.